AirAsia To Raise USD$824 Mln In 2010


Malaysian budget carrier AirAsia needs to raise MYR3 billion ringgit (USD$823.5 million) next year as it expects to take delivery of another 24 new aircraft, a company official said on Wednesday.

Mohshin Aziz, investor relations manager at AirAsia, said the MYR3 billion was on top of the MYR2 billion planned for 2009.

AirAsia told investors in March it needs to raise MYR2 billion to MYR2.1 billion in order to take delivery of 14 Airbus A320 aircraft this year.

Investment bank UBS said AirAsia disclosed early this year that it had secured funding for its aircraft deliveries in 2009 and 2010.

"Management have indicated that these facilities contain no material covenants, so we would be surprised if the company faced any funding difficulties over the next couple of years," said UBS in a report published on Tuesday.
